HORTIS v. MADISON GOLF CLUB, INC.


92 A.D.2d 713 (1983)

John Hortis, Respondent, v. Madison Golf Club, Inc.,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Fourth Department.

February 28, 1983


Judgment unanimously affirmed, with costs. Memorandum: This is an action for money damages for breach of an employment contract, dated March 19, 1979, which provided, in relevant part, that for the period April 1, 1979 to October 31, 1979 plaintiff would serve as manager of defendant's bar and would be paid $250 per week.
